Looksmaxxing Apps: A Growing Threat to Adolescent Mental Health
The rise of looksmaxxing apps, which use AI to score facial attractiveness, is raising concerns among mental health professionals. These apps, popular among teenage boys, promote narrow beauty standards and may contribute to body dysmorphia and eating disorders. Experts warn that the lack of age verification and unvalidated scoring methods pose significant risks to vulnerable youth, particularly those from marginalized communities.
